1

Senior Linux Systems Engineer Jobs in Colorado (NOW HIRING)

In this position you will work on Windows and Linux systems, providing day-to-day administration ... THE WORK As a Senior System Engineer-IT, you will: โ€ข Duties primarily focused on Linux/Unix ...

At CesiumAstro , we are developers and pioneers of out-of-the-box communication systems for ... CesiumAstro is seeking a Linux Administrator II to support the infrastructure, systems ...

At CesiumAstro , we are developers and pioneers of out-of-the-box communication systems for ... CesiumAstro is seeking a Linux Administrator II to support the infrastructure, systems ...

Senior Systems Engineer

Aurora, CO ยท On-site

$130K - $175K/yr

We are currently seeking a Sr Systems Engineer to provide engineering support to our Buckley SFB ... Experience with operating systems, including Windows and Linux, application behaviors, and network ...

PeopleTec is currently seeking a Senior Systems Engineer to support our Buckley SFB, Aurora, CO ... Experience with operating systems, including Windows and Linux, application behaviors, and network ...

Senior Systems Engineer

Aurora, CO ยท On-site

$130K - $175K/yr

We are currently seeking a Sr Systems Engineer to provide engineering support to our Buckley SFB ... Experience with operating systems, including Windows and Linux, application behaviors, and network ...

Senior Systems Engineer

Littleton, CO ยท On-site

$78K - $145K/yr

Senior Systems Engineer Requisition ID: 1761 Position Location: Littleton, Colorado Position Reports To: Director, Systems Engineering Supervises Others: No Salary Range: $78,000 - $145,000 At ...

next page

Showing results 1-20

Senior Linux Systems Engineer information

See Colorado salary details

$105.7K

$134.5K

$166.7K

How much do senior linux systems engineer jobs pay per year?

As of Jul 3, 2026, the average yearly pay for senior linux systems engineer in Colorado is $134,517.00, according to ZipRecruiter salary data. Most workers in this role earn between $124,100.00 and $145,100.00 per year, depending on experience, location, and employer.

What does a Senior Linux Systems Engineer do?

A Senior Linux Systems Engineer is responsible for designing, implementing, and maintaining complex Linux-based systems and servers within an organization. Their duties often include configuring system architecture, ensuring system security and reliability, automating processes with scripting, and troubleshooting advanced issues. They may also mentor junior engineers, manage large-scale deployments, and contribute to planning the IT infrastructure. This role requires deep expertise in Linux operating systems, networking, and system optimization.

How does a Senior Linux Systems Engineer typically collaborate with development and security teams?

A Senior Linux Systems Engineer often works closely with development teams to ensure that infrastructure is tailored to the needs of applications, facilitating smooth deployments and resolving compatibility issues. Collaboration with security teams is also essential, as they help implement and maintain system hardening, intrusion detection, and compliance with security policies. Regular meetings, ticketing systems, and cross-functional project planning are common ways these teams work together to ensure system reliability, security, and performance.

What is the difference between Senior Linux Systems Engineer vs Linux Systems Administrator?

AspectSenior Linux Systems EngineerLinux Systems Administrator
CertificationsLinux Professional Institute Certification (LPIC), RHCELPIC, RHCE often preferred
Work EnvironmentDesigning, implementing, and optimizing Linux infrastructureMaintaining, monitoring, and supporting Linux systems
ResponsibilitiesAdvanced system architecture, scripting, troubleshooting complex issuesRoutine system setup, updates, user management
Industry UsageTech companies, data centers, cloud providersEnterprises, hosting providers, IT departments

The main difference is that Senior Linux Systems Engineers focus on designing and optimizing Linux infrastructure, while Linux Systems Administrators handle daily maintenance and support tasks. The engineer role involves more strategic planning and complex problem-solving, whereas the administrator role emphasizes operational support and system stability.

What are the key skills and qualifications needed to thrive as a Senior Linux Systems Engineer, and why are they important?

To thrive as a Senior Linux Systems Engineer, you need expert-level knowledge of Linux/Unix systems administration, scripting languages (such as Bash or Python), and a degree in computer science or a related field. Familiarity with configuration management tools (like Ansible or Puppet), cloud platforms (AWS, Azure), and relevant certifications (e.g., RHCE, LFCS) are highly valued. Strong problem-solving abilities, effective communication, and the ability to mentor junior engineers distinguish top performers in this role. These skills and qualities are vital for ensuring system reliability, optimizing performance, and driving team success in complex IT environments.
What cities in Colorado are hiring for Senior Linux Systems Engineer jobs? Cities in Colorado with the most Senior Linux Systems Engineer job openings:
What are popular job titles related to Senior Linux Systems Engineer jobs in CO? For Senior Linux Systems Engineer jobs in CO, the most frequently searched job titles are:
Infographic showing various Senior Linux Systems Engineer job openings in Colorado as of June 2026, with employment types broken down into 9% As Needed, 72% Full Time, 11% Part Time, 2% Temporary, 4% Contract, and 2% Nights. Highlights an 91% Physical, 2% Hybrid, and 7% Remote job distribution, with an average salary of $134,517 per year, or $64.7 per hour.
Linux Infrastructure Engineer II/III

Linux Infrastructure Engineer II/III

The National Renewable Energy Laboratory (NREL)

Golden, CO โ€ข On-site

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ted 8 days ago


Job description

Posting Title
Linux Infrastructure Engineer II/III
Location
CO - Golden
Position Type
Regular
Hours Per Week
40
Working at NLR
NLR is located at the foothills of the Rocky Mountains in Golden, Colorado is the nation's primary laboratory for energy systems research and development.
Join the National Laboratory of the Rockies (NLR), where world-class scientists, engineers, and experts are accelerating energy innovation through breakthrough research and systems integration. From our mission to our collaborative culture, NLR stands out in the research community for its commitment to an affordable and secure energy future. Spanning foundational science to applied systems engineering and analysis, we focus on solving complex challenges to deliver advanced, secure, reliable, and cost-effective energy solutions. Our work helps strengthen U.S. industries, support job creation, and promote national economic growth.
At NLR, you'll find a mission-driven environment supported by state-of-the-art facilities, multidisciplinary research teams, and strong collaborations with industry, academia, and other national laboratories. We offer robust professional development opportunities, and a competitive benefits package designed to support your career and well-being.
Job Description
NLR's Computational Science Center (CSC) conducts research to advance the science of computing across advanced computer science, visualization, data science, AI/ML, applied math, and computational science, as well as providing computing expertise to the NLR community and staffing for project execution. The CSC's Advanced Computing Operations (ACO) Group facilitates cutting edge computational innovations and testbeds to find tomorrow's solutions today. Collaboration is at the heart of our work - our staff partner with scientists across NLR to deeply understand their computational challenges, to develop or co-develop tailored solutions, and leveraging our hybrid compute offerings, to provide the technical expertise needed to push boundaries to deliver integrated energy systems solutions. The CSC's ACO Group has an immediate opening for a Linux Infrastructure Engineer to support the infrastructure around the centers HPC, Research Computing, and on-premises cloud.
In this role, you will leverage your broad expertise across Linux system administration, networking, security, scripting, and container technologies to engineer, deploy, and manage infrastructure that supports high-performance computing (HPC), complex data workflows and advanced analytics. The ideal candidate will have a versatile skill set and a strategic mindset, capable of optimizing high-performance data environments while solving complex problems, enhancing efficiency, and improving reliability and scalability through collaboration and innovative problem-solving.
  • Design, engineer, and deploy Linux-based solutions to support data management, HPC, data analysis, processing, and visualization tools and platforms.
  • Collaborate with researchers to translate their technical needs into effective infrastructure and application solutions.
  • Install, configure, and maintain Linux systems, ensuring they are optimized for science applications and large-scale workloads.
  • Develop, maintain, and support containerized environments (e.g., Docker, Podman, Kubernetes) to enable seamless deployment and management of tools and applications.
  • Perform regular server maintenance (hardware and software), updates, security patching, and system hardening to ensure data integrity and security compliance.
  • Troubleshoot and resolve complex server, application, and network issues that impact data workflows and performance.
  • Evaluate new technologies, tools, and methodologies to enhance the efficiency, reliability, and scalability of the infrastructure supporting data and visualization efforts.
  • Automate routine tasks and workflows to enhance efficiency and reduce operational overhead.

Basic Qualifications
Level II:
Relevant Bachelor's Degree and 2 or more years of experience or equivalent relevant education/experience. Or, relevant Master's Degree or equivalent relevant education/experience. General knowledge and application of standards, principles, concepts and techniques in specific field. Some understanding of related IS practices and standards. Skilled in analytical techniques and practices, and problem solving. Skilled in written and verbal communication. Intermediate programming ability with various computer software programs and information systems.
Level III:
Relevant Bachelor's Degree and 5 or more years of experience or equivalent relevant education/experience. Or, relevant Master's Degree and 3 or more years of experience or equivalent relevant education/experience. Or, relevant PhD or equivalent relevant education/experience. Complete understanding and wide application of principles, concepts and techniques in specific field. General knowledge of related IS disciplines. Strong leadership and project management skills. Skilled in analytical techniques, practices and problem solving. Advanced programming, design and analysis abilities with various computer software programs and information systems.
Eligibility requirements: This position will require access to sensitive information, Government facilities, and/or Government information systems restricted to individuals with US citizenship. Only applicants that are US Citizens at the time of application will be considered.
* Must meet educational requirements prior to employment start date.
Additional Required Qualifications
  • Experience in Linux system administration (2 years at II and 5 years at III).
  • Proven ability to design and implement secure, scalable, and performant infrastructure to support complex data pipelines and analysis tools.
  • Strong problem-solving skills with the ability to quickly diagnose and resolve technical issues impacting data processing and analysis.
  • Excellent communication and collaboration skills to work effectively with researchers, research operations, analysts, and cross-functional teams.

Preferred Qualifications
Level II and level III:
  • Familiarity with Git and handling branches, merging, and conflict resolution
  • Automated configuration management using Ansible
  • Knowledge of computer hardware and how to manage, deploy, and service it.
  • Experience with enterprise level directory services OpenLDAP, RHEL IdM/IPA, or similar.

Level III:
  • Familiarity with building, supporting, and life-cycling containers (Podman, Kubernetes, docker).
  • Experience working with on-premises cloud environments (VMware, OpenStack, Proxmox, OpenShift).

Job Application Submission Window
The anticipated closing window for application submission is up to 30 days and may be extended as needed.
Annual Salary Range (based on full-time 40 hours per week)
Job Profile: IT Professional III / Annual Salary Range: $100,400 - $180,700
Job Profile: IT Professional II / Annual Salary Range: $83,600 - $150,500
NLR takes into consideration a candidate's education, training, and experience, expected quality and quantity of work, required travel (if any), external market and internal value, including seniority and merit systems, and internal pay alignment when determining the salary level for potential new employees. In compliance with the Colorado Equal Pay for Equal Work Act, a potential new employee's salary history will not be used in compensation decisions.
Benefits Summary
Benefits include medical, dental, and vision insurance; short*- and long-term disability insurance; pension benefits*; 403(b) Employee Savings Plan with employer match*; life and accidental death and dismemberment (AD&D) insurance; personal time off (PTO) and sick leave; paid holidays; and tuition reimbursement*. NLR employees may be eligible for, but are not guaranteed, performance-, merit-, and achievement- based awards that include a monetary component. Some positions may be eligible for relocation expense reimbursement. Limited-term positions are not eligible for long-term disability or tuition reimbursement.
* Based on eligibility rules
Badging Requirement
NLR is subject to Department of Energy (DOE) access restrictions. All employees must also be able to obtain and maintain a federal Personal Identity Verification (PIV) card as required by Homeland Security Presidential Directive 12 (HSPD-12), which includes a favorable background investigation.
Drug Free Workplace
NLR is committed to maintaining a drug-free workplace in accordance with the federal Drug-Free Workplace Act and complies with federal laws prohibiting the possession and use of illegal drugs. Under federal law, marijuana remains an illegal drug.
If you are offered employment at NLR, you must pass a pre-employment drug test prior to commencing employment. Unless prohibited by state or local law, the pre-employment drug test will include marijuana. If you test positive on the pre-employment drug test, your offer of employment may be withdrawn.
Submission Guidelines
Please note that in order to be considered an applicant for any position at NLR you must submit an application form for each position for which you believe you are qualified. Applications are not kept on file for future positions. Please include a cover letter and resume with each position application.
Equal Opportunity Employer
All qualified applicants will receive consideration for employment without regard basis of age (40 and over), color, disability, gender identity, genetic information, marital status, domestic partner status, military or veteran status, national origin/ancestry, race, religion, creed, sex (including pregnancy, childbirth, breastfeeding), sexual orientation, and any other applicable status protected by federal, state, or local laws.
Reasonable Accommodations
E-Verify www.dhs.gov/E-Verify For information about right to work, click here for English or here for Spanish.
E-Verify is a registered trademark of the U.S. Department of Homeland Security. This business uses E-Verify in its hiring practices to achieve a lawful workforce.